Expert Guide to Grading Wheat Pennies on the Sheldon Scale

Albert Coinstein7 months ago5 months ago07 mins

Grading Wheat Pennies can be simple if you understand these easy steps. Wheat cents are a popular choice for coin collectors due to their historical significance and unique design. They were minted from 1909 to 1958 and feature the image of Abraham Lincoln on the obverse side and two wheat stalks on the reverse side….
